Transaction 5ecd642b05023afe117bb10547b8c4927cfa50e4e9a14e7a195886d387657813
1 Input
1 Output
-
5ecd642b05023afe117bb10547b8c4927cfa50e4e9a14e7a195886d387657813:0
- value
- 102693320
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 48cf77352d9a649b06fe9eedbca38b06e2e8a64d OP_EQUALVERIFY OP_CHECKSIG
- address
- 17dzBn8wnmbhNTt76tvSvy3amEZuifcQfU